Output 61c59fe7441eaa740ce950692dc1e622408b09bcb87804f5b8cce81f990a811e:0

value
4465017
script pubkey
OP_0 OP_PUSHBYTES_20 250e04927757d6f310b96c2193540c386d126c9a
address
bc1qy58qfynh2lt0xy9edssex4qv8pk3ymy6rhuyr0
transaction
61c59fe7441eaa740ce950692dc1e622408b09bcb87804f5b8cce81f990a811e
confirmations
81790
spent
true